Output e6fbe0c163a3d7a1a5833d5958b7ca075ad31ce58bdbc34df49c5dd01846ec8c:13

value
17653
script pubkey
OP_0 OP_PUSHBYTES_20 c7b546bc7b132f52ae867d56c39182d8b5119cba
address
bc1qc765d0rmzvh49t5x04tv8yvzmz63r896lp36m5
transaction
e6fbe0c163a3d7a1a5833d5958b7ca075ad31ce58bdbc34df49c5dd01846ec8c
confirmations
28147
spent
true